Musgravetown sits along the inner reaches of Bonavista Bay, offering a relaxed coastal pace with easy access to everyday conveniences and big landscapes. Residents enjoy small-town familiarity while staying connected to regional hubs like Clarenville and Glovertown, plus scenic drives to Eastport and Port Blandford. Local wharves and sheltered coves shape the daily rhythm.
Weekend plans often start outdoors. Nearby Terra Nova National Park showcases sheltered inlets, boreal forest, and family-friendly trailheads. Beach days on the Eastport Peninsula are an easy outing, while winter brings downhill turns and summer hiking and mountain biking at White Hills Resort. Anglers, paddlers, birders, and snowmobilers all find plenty of room to roam.
Schools are a priority: Musgravetown Academy supports local learners and is part of the Newfoundland and Labrador English School District. Healthcare, shopping, and restaurants in nearby towns round out the essentials, and community events dot neighbouring communities. Reliable internet supports remote and hybrid work.
Housing ranges from tidy side-street homes to ocean-view properties and larger lots, appealing to first-time buyers, growing families, and retirees.
